           | I think the main limitation, right now, is hardware. For GPUs
           | the main limit is the VRAM available on consumer models. CPUs
           | have plenty of memory but don't have the bandwidth or vector
           | compute power for LLMs. This is why I think the Strix Halo is
           | so exciting: it has bandwidth + compute power plus a lot of
           | memory. It's not quite where it needs to be to replace a
           | dedicated GPU, but in a few iterations it could be.

       | killerstorm wrote:
       | > "In our attention design, a transformer block with softmax
       | attention follows every seven transnormer blocks (Qin et al.,
       | 2022a) with lightning attention."
       | 
       | Alright, so it's 87.5% linear attention + 12.5% full attention.
       | 
       | TBH I find the terminology around "linear attention" rather
       | confusing.
       | 
       | "Softmax attention" is an information routing mechanism: when
       | token `k` is being computed, it can receive information from
       | tokens 1..k, but it has to be crammed through a channel of a
       | fixed size.
       | 
       | "Linear attention", on the other hand, is just a 'register bank'
       | of a fixed size available to each layer. It's not real attention,
       | it's attention only in the sense it's compatible with layer-at-
       | once computation.
